WhatsApp Contact Form Generator
Build an embeddable contact form that opens WhatsApp pre-filled with the visitor's message. No backend, no server. Paste and go.
No spaces, dashes, or + prefix. Example: 971501234567
Leave blank to skip the custom field.
Using a contact form on your website?
FormBeep sends you a WhatsApp notification the moment someone submits it. Free to try.
Try FormBeep freeWant submissions delivered to you — no WhatsApp required from the visitor?
This tool opens WhatsApp on the visitor's device, which means they need WhatsApp to contact you.
FormBeep works differently: your visitor submits a normal form, and you get the notification on WhatsApp. They don't need WhatsApp at all.
Free plan available • No credit card • 2-minute setup
What is a WhatsApp contact form?
A WhatsApp contact form is a standard HTML form embedded on your website. When a visitor fills it in and clicks submit, instead of sending an email, it opens WhatsApp on their device with a pre-written message containing all their details — ready to send to your number. It's the quickest way to turn a website visitor into a WhatsApp conversation.
How to add a WhatsApp form to any website
This generator creates a self-contained HTML snippet with no dependencies. Paste it into your site's HTML — in a Webflow embed block, a WordPress custom HTML widget, a Wix HTML app, a Squarespace code block, or directly in your <body>. The form works immediately with no server or back-end setup required.
WhatsApp contact forms vs. email contact forms
Email contact forms land in inboxes that often go unchecked for hours. WhatsApp messages are read within minutes — the average open rate is 98%. For businesses that rely on fast lead response (consultants, agencies, local services, real estate), a WhatsApp form means you can reply before a competitor does.
Frequently asked questions
Does the visitor need WhatsApp installed?
Yes. Submitting the form opens a wa.me link on the visitor's device. On mobile this launches the WhatsApp app; on desktop it opens WhatsApp Web. If the visitor doesn't have WhatsApp, they'll see a download prompt. If you want visitors to contact you without needing WhatsApp themselves, use FormBeep instead.
Which website builders does this work with?
Any website that allows custom HTML embeds — Webflow, Wix, Squarespace, WordPress, Framer, Shopify, Ghost, plain HTML sites, and more. Paste the generated code into a custom HTML block and it works.
Is there a backend or server required?
No. The code is 100% client-side HTML and JavaScript. When the visitor submits the form, their browser builds the WhatsApp message and opens the link. No data passes through any server.
Can I use this on multiple websites?
Yes. Generate a separate snippet for each site (or the same one) and paste it anywhere you like. There are no limits.
What's the difference between this and FormBeep?
This tool requires the visitor to have WhatsApp — they send the message themselves. FormBeep works differently: the visitor fills a normal form, and you get a WhatsApp notification. The visitor doesn't need WhatsApp at all.